Details
A vulnerability has been found in Oracle NoSQL Database up to 19.3.11 and classified as very critical. Affected by this vulnerability is an unknown function of the component Oracle NoSQL Database. The manipulation with an unknown input leads to a server-side request forgery vulnerability. The CWE definition for the vulnerability is CWE-918. The web server receives a URL or similar request from an upstream component and retrieves the contents of this URL, but it does not sufficiently ensure that the request is being sent to the expected destination. As an impact it is known to affect confidentiality, integrity, and availability.
The weakness was presented 10/16/2019 as Oracle Critical Patch Update Advisory - October 2019 as confirmed advisory (Website). It is possible to read the advisory at oracle.com. This vulnerability is known as CVE-2018-14721. The attack can be launched remotely. The exploitation doesn't need any form of authentication. The technical details are unknown and an exploit is not publicly available. The pricing for an exploit might be around USD $5k-$25k at the moment (estimation calculated on 08/13/2024).
We expect the 0-day to have been worth approximately $25k-$100k. The commercial vulnerability scanner Qualys is able to test this issue with plugin 176909 (Debian Security Update for jackson-databind (DSA 4452-1)).
Upgrading eliminates this vulnerability. A possible mitigation has been published immediately after the disclosure of the vulnerability.
